L'organisation Go Playground sur GitHub est dédiée à l'avancement de Go à travers une variété de bibliothèques et de packages. Ses projets principaux incluent des outils tels que validator, webhooks et form, qui sont largement utilisés dans la communauté Go. Avec une forte présence dans les langages Go et JavaScript, Go Playground contribue significativement à l'écosystème des développeurs.
:100:Go Struct and Field validation, including Cross Field, Cross Struct, Map, Slice and Array diving
:fishing_pole_and_fish: Webhook receiver for GitHub, Bitbucket, GitLab, Gogs
:steam_locomotive: Decodes url.Values into Go value(s) and Encodes Go value(s) into url.Values. Dual Array and Full map support.
:speedboat: a limited consumer goroutine or unlimited goroutine pool for easier goroutine handling and cancellation
:speech_balloon: i18n Translator for Go/Golang using CLDR data + pluralization rules
:rotating_light: Is a lightweight, fast and extensible zero allocation HTTP router for Go used to create customizable frameworks.
:earth_americas: a set of locales generated from the CLDR Project which can be used independently or within an i18n package; these were built for use with, but not exclusive to https://github.com/go-playground/universal-translator
:scissors: Is a general library to help modify or set data within data structures and other objects.
:green_book: Simple, configurable and scalable Structured Logging for Go.
:chart_with_upwards_trend: Monitors Go MemStats + System stats such as Memory, Swap and CPU and sends via UDP anywhere you want for logging etc...
:non-potable_water: Is a lightweight HTTP router that sticks to the std "net/http" implementation
:jeans:Multi-Package go project coverprofile for tools like goveralls
:file_folder: Embeds static resources into go files for single binary compilation + works with http.FileSystem + symlinks
:exclamation:Basic Assertion Library used along side native go testing, with building blocks for custom assertions
:boom:Error Context, Stack Trace, Types and Tags for full error handling and logging.
:art: Go color manipulation, conversion and printing library/utility
:star: pkg extends the core go packages with missing or additional functionality built in. All packages correspond to the std go package name with an additional suffix of `ext` to avoid naming conflicts.
:hocho: Is a library that aids in graceful shutdown of a process/application
Timezone Country and Zone data generated from timezonedb.com
:runner:runs go generate recursively on a specified path or environment variable and can filter by regex
simple auto-compile daemon that just works
:arrows_counterclockwise: Retry provides a set of standardized common components and abstracts away some code that normally is duplicated
provides base types who's values should never be seen by the human eye, but still used for configuration.
library + program to help making zero downtime, self-upgrading programs and servers.
:black_large_square: ansi contains a bunch of constants and possibly additional terminal related functionality in the future.
a JSON data expression lexer, parser, cli and library
:bowtie: Backoff uses an exponential backoff algorithm to backoff between retries with optional auto-tuning functionality.
Contains multiple in-memory cache implementations including LRU & LFU
Go Iteration tools with a rusty flavour
:raised_hands: ws creates a hub for WebSocket connections and abstracts away allot of the boilerplate code for managing connections using Gorilla WebSocket
Asset Pipeline for Go HTML applications
This package is a Go client for the Relay Job Runner https://github.com/rust-playground/relay-rs
:repeat: is an asset live-reload library that allows easy registration of path & file change monitoring and notifications for https://github.com/livereload/livereload-js
Bare building blocks for backing off and can be used to build more complex backoff packages
Generic Bundler to concatenate any type of files using a custom left and right delimiter, i.e. css or js files
:key: Gorilla's session store implementation using MongoDB
:wavy_dash: Package wave is a thin helper layer on top of Go's net/rpc
